Pressure group urges Pala to execute development projects

Nongpoh: The Shakoikuna Area of Inter-state Border Development Organization (SAIBO), an organization comprising of various headmen looking after the welfare and development of Shakoikuna Area, which still lacking behind in terms of development comparing to other areas of Ri Bhoi, has urged MP, Vincent H Pala to put his assurance into effect for the benefit of the local people of the area.
Liander Nongshli, Chairman of SAIBO informed that the organization in a meeting with Vincent H Pala, has put forward various issues pertaining to the development of the backward area where the MP assured the delegation that he will take up the issue with the State Government.
Nongshli also informed that the organization had requested the MP for availing scheme for blacktopping of a 1.6 kilometers road from Umdapdumu to Shakoikuna.
The MP had assured them that he will take up this matter with the State PWD Minister.
‘Other requirements put forth by the organization to the MP includes creation of a new Sub-Center at Shakoikuna, construction of new school building for RCUP School Umdap, and a football ground at Umdaprngi,’ he said.
Nongshli on behalf of the organization expresses their gratefulness to the MP for contributing Rs 5 lakhs under the MP Scheme to the Catholic Church of Umdap for the upcoming Silver Jubilee celebration and also for consecration of Deacon Kmenlang Nongrum of St Franciss Asisi falling under Byrnihat Parish in Ri Bhoi.
